Mirch Masala specializes in halal North Indian Cuisine, where cooks typically use rich spices and aromatic herbs to transform intricate conjurations of vegetables, lentils, and rice into tasty meals that are as fulfilling as they are filling. Went for a Valentines Day dinner with my significant other in Feb. They had a special buffet going on that night. The halal status is unconfirmed though some of the staff that were there did confirm it was. We had the buffet I stayed towards the vegetarian dishes and orders a la carte of the menu. The food was decent nothing that I would return for. The taste was alright for most of the items we tried such as paneer tikka masala, aloo samosas. The naan however was delicious and it literally was melt in your mouth good.
